l-Amino acid ligase catalyzes dipeptide synthesis from unprotected l-amino acids in an ATP- dependent manner. We have purified a new l-amino acid ligase, RizA, which synthesizes dipeptides whose N-terminus is Arg, from Bacillus subtilis NBRC3134, a microorganism that produces a rhizocticin peptide antibiotic.
